Establishment profile
FOOT LEVELERS INC
518 POCAHONTAS AVENUE, ROANOKE, VA, 24012
339112 — Surgical and Medical Instrument Manufacturing
Summary
FOOT LEVELERS INC has accumulated 12 OSHA violations across 5 inspections over 25 years of recorded history, with $5,600 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 89th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 46 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 91st perc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 3 years ago.

Inspection history
| Date | Trigger | Violations | Serious | Penalty |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023-03-28 | Complaint |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 2014-02-04 | Planned |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 2008-03-03 | Complaint |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 2005-02-22 | Planned | 6 | 6 | $2,415 | |
| 2000-10-11 | Planned | 6 | 4 | $3,185 |
Source: OSHA IMIS. Citation amounts reflect initially assessed penalties; final amounts after appeal may differ.
